Maharashtra Assembly polls: NCP, Congress rely on trusted netas to garner votes

  • The Nationalist Congress Party released their star campaigners list on Saturday for Maharashtra state assembly polls. The NCP pinned their hope on their senior leaders like Ajit Pawar, Praful Patel, actor-turned-politician Amol Kolhe and social activist Sushma Andhare and Pradeep Salunkhe to garner the votes for assembly polls.
  • The NCP star campaigners' list also added 40 leaders. In this list, the firebrand NCP leaders Ajit Pawar, Chhagan Bhujbal, Dhananjay Munde, Supriya Sule, Nawab Malik and Jitendra Awhad are included as their star campaigners .
  • “We have submitted our star campaigner list to the Election Commission (EC). We will design the programme for all these campaigners and they will campaign against the incumbent government and their anti-people policies.

  • There are very few days left for voting which is scheduled for October 21.
  • But we will try and reach out to all voters who want to dethrone the current government,” said NCP spokesperson Nawab Malik.
